推广 热搜: 广场  Java  app  Word  营业  微信公众号  北京代理记账  商城  代理记账  商标交易 

编译并安装libusb库 怎样编译Qt下的Oracle驱动?

   2023-04-29 企业服务招财猫120
核心提示:中Windows下编译的Oracle驱动打开项目:C:Qt4.8.1srcplugingsqldriversoci修改:targetqsqlociourcesmain。CPP包括(.../.../..

中Windows下编译的Oracle驱动打开项目:C:Qt4.8.1srcplugingsqldriversoci修改:targetqsqlociourcesmain。CPP包括(.../.../.../SQL/drivers/OCI/QSQL_)includ:oracle2product11.2.0dbhome_1accinclud:Oracle2product11.2.0dbhome_1occilibsvc编译完成后,将库文件复制到:编译Oracle驱动程序打开项目:/usr/local/Qt-4.5.2/src/plugins/SQLdrivers/OCI查看并修改项目文件:[OCI]$cattargetqsqlocheads.../.../SQL/drivers/OCI/qsql_OCI.hsourcesmain.CPP../../../SQL/drivers/OCI/qsql_OCI.cpplibpath/u01/app/··LIBS*包含(libs,。*客户。*):libs*-lclntshmacx:qmake_lflags-wl,-flat_namespace,-u,_可以,所以库实际上是一个动态链接库。1.放入Android系统,每个应用都可以访问并把编译好的文件放到系统的/system/lib目录下。在Eclipse上打开ADT插件中的文件浏览器工具,点击/system/lib目录,选择右上角的一个pusha文件到设备上,打开对话框,然后选择文件,再确认把lib文件放到手机上。(如果没有,也可以用ADB自有adb推送命令)。然后将其权限设置为744,命令如下:#访问手机设备adbshell#通过命令行#进入/system/lib目录cd/system/lib#设置。权限是744chmod744。此时,使用Jni机制编写一个加载Jni库方法的类。在课上,Jni接口2要严格按照Jni机制编写,并投入应用软件。只有你自己的应用程序才能访问①软件工程下新创建的libs/armeabi文件夹,并将库复制到其中。②下一步是重写Jni接口,与方法1的最后一个过程相同。

 
反对 0举报 0 收藏 0 打赏 0评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
合作伙伴
网站首页  |  关于我们  |  联系方式  |  使用协议  |  版权隐私  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报  |  冀ICP备2023006999号-8